U.S. Urges Armenian Police, Protesters To Show Restraint

The United States called on the Armenian authorities and protesters in Yerevan to exercise caution in their continuing standoff over an electricity price hike which seemed to escalate late on Sunday.

"Concerned by tense situation [in] downtown [Yerevan,]" the U.S. Embassy in Armenia wrote on its Twitter page. "Urge all sides to display peaceful, restrained behavior befitting democratic values."

The statement followed renewed threats by the Armenian police to forcibly disperse scores of protesters blocking a central Yerevan avenue for the seventh consecutive day. Despite those threats, most protesters decided to stay put until the authorities officially and unconditionally revoke a more than 17 percent surge in energy tariffs.
